Understanding the Remote Work Landscape

As the global shift towards remote work evolves, South Africa's job landscape is undergoing significant transformations. Recent changes to employment regulations, coupled with economic pressures, have created an environment that is becoming less favorable for remote workers.

The Impact of Regulatory Changes

In recent months, South African authorities have implemented new regulations that directly affect the remote working scenario. Notably, the government's stance on employment standards has heightened scrutiny on how remote jobs are classified.

New Employment Classifications

The introduction of stricter guidelines for remote job classifications has resulted in many companies reevaluating their employment models. This has led to a reduction in the availability of remote positions, as businesses seek to comply with the new standards.

Current Job Market Trends

According to a recent report from local job boards, there has been a significant decline in remote work listings in major South African cities such as Johannesburg and Cape Town. This trend reflects a broader national concern regarding job security and economic stability.

Statistics on Job Listings

  • Remote job listings have decreased by 25% in the past year.
  • Surveys indicate that nearly 40% of professionals seek remote work but face hurdles in finding suitable positions.

The Broader Economic Context

Understanding the challenges faced by remote workers in South Africa requires considering the broader economic climate. With inflation rates on the rise and a competitive job market, many companies are opting for in-office work to maintain productivity and cohesion.

Sector-specific Challenges

Certain sectors, particularly tech and customer service, have shifted their focus away from remote positions. Companies argue that in-person collaboration fosters innovation and improves team dynamics, which are vital in a rapidly changing economy.

What This Means for Job Seekers

For professionals considering remote work in South Africa, it's crucial to adapt to these changing conditions. Emphasizing skills in demand and understanding employer preferences can help job seekers navigate this challenging landscape.

Strategies for Success

  • Focus on developing remote-friendly skills like digital communication and project management.
  • Network with industry professionals to uncover potential remote job opportunities.
  • Consider freelance or contract roles as alternatives to full-time remote positions.
